Man Utd legend Charlton: Busby knew Ferguson was right choice

Manchester United legend Sir Bobby Charlton says Sir Matt Busby always knew they had found the right manager in Sir Alex Ferguson.

In his 80s when Ferguson arrived, Busby's influence was huge. His words and reassurance counted for a huge amount.

"Matt was still around," said Charlton. "Sometimes you would have a little chat about things but he was in no doubt either.

"He didn't have a worry at all. He knew we had the right man."

It is one of Ferguson's great joys that Busby was still alive and at Old Trafford to celebrate at the party that followed a day after that 26-year wait for the title had been brought to an end.

The elation on Busby's face when United took the field for the carnival night against Blackburn after Aston Villa had failed to overcome Oldham gave away his feelings.

After building a club around his own European odyssey, the tragedy of Munich and glory against Benfica in the 1968 European Cup final, Busby knew United had a worthy successor.

"That night was magic," recalled Charlton. "The old man was so happy. He loved Alex as well. He couldn't help it.

"Alex had this personality. He made things happen. Every part of the club was buzzing.

"There is no way that, even had we lost at Nottingham Forest, anything would have happened. No way at all.

"Everyone knew where we were going and what was going to happen."
